CarMax Inc
CONSUMER CYCLICAL · AUTO & TRUCK DEALERSHIPS · USA
CarMax is a used vehicle retailer based in the United States. It operates two business segments: CarMax Sales Operations and CarMax Auto Finance.

CONSUMER DEFENSIVE · TOBACCO · USA
Turning Point Brands, Inc. manufactures, markets and distributes branded consumer products. The company is headquartered in Louisville, Kentucky.
